Tuscan Steaks

Servings: 4          Prep Time: 10 min.          Cook Time: 25 min.
The preparation of a fabulous grilled steak is simple so it's all about the quality of the meat. Choose porterhouse or strip steaks for this recipe.
 

INGREDIENTS

DIRECTIONS

• 2 lb porterhouse steak
• 2 clove(s) garlic, finely chopped
• 1 tbsp rosemary (fresh), chopped
• 6 leaves sage (fresh)
• 1/3 cup(s) olive oil

1. Preheat the grill over high heat. Brush with oil when ready to cook.

2. Season the steak with kosher salt and pepper. Grill for 10 - 14 minutes per side for 1 1/2 to 2 inch thick steaks.

3. Meanwhile, on the serving platter, scatter the garlic, rosemary and sage leaves. Arrange the grilled steak on top and pour good olive oil over the top. Turn the steak a few times to coat. Let it sit in the oil and herbs for 3 or 4 minutes.

4. Cut the steak off the bone and slice into 1/4 inch thick slices. Baste the meat with the oil and juices and serve.
